This document summarizes different vector graphic options for use on the web. It discusses the differences between vector and raster graphics, and why vectors are preferable for resolution independence and smaller file sizes. It then examines SVG, Canvas, VML, and CSS3 as vector graphic options, outlining browser support, APIs, and common uses for each. While SVG is ideal theoretically, browser support is still limited, so libraries like SVG Web and Raphael.js are recommended to abstract cross-browser differences. In the end, SVG is generally better than Canvas for interactive graphics with events, while Canvas may be better for full-screen animations and games.
2. Vector vs. Raster
Raster = Pixels = Bitmaps = .PNG, .JPEG ...
Vector = Primitives = Shapes = .AI, .SVG
Vectors can easily be “Rasterized” at a
certain resolution into Bitmaps
Rasters cannot easily be “Vectorized”
without a whole lot of work

28. Pixels?
Where are the Vectors?
<canvas> only stores pixel data.
But, <canvas> has drawing primitives for:
Rectangles, Lines, Quadtratic & Beizer Curves, Arcs,
Fills, Text, Gradients...
All drawing is done via a Javascript API

40. CSS3 features that replace
bitmap hacks:
Rounded corners - *-border-radius
Drop shadows: *-box-shadow
Text Shadows: text-shadow
Gradients: *-gradient
Fonts: @font-face
41. CSS3 Caveats
You probably want to use a CSS Framework
such as SASS/LESS to DRY the vendor prefixes.
IE6-8 - fake it with http://css3pie.com/

50. SVG vs. Canvas
SVG Canvas
Persistent Scene Graph Just Pixels (can R/W)
Hover, Click Events Own Event calculations
Browser does the work Full canvas refresh
